The Evansville Central Bears's homestand will continue as they prepare to take on the Princeton Tigers at 5:30 p.m. on Wednesday.
Evansville Central is coming in off a wild two-game stretch: after soaring to four goals two weeks ago, they were much more limited against Evansville Reitz on Thursday. They came up short against the Panthers, falling 5-1. While losing is never fun, the Bears can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Indiana soccer rankings (they are ranked 102nd, while the Panthers are ranked 27th).
Evansville Central's goal came courtesy of
Sydnee Robinson, who's now up to four this season.
Meanwhile, after low-scoring totals in their previous three contests, Princeton brought some dynamite into their most recent contest. They put the hurt on Boonville with a sharp 5-2 win on Monday. Considering the Tigers have won three matches by more than two goals this season, Monday's blowout was nothing new.
Evansville Central has been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four matchups, which put a noticeable dent in their 2-5 record this season. As for Princeton, their victory ended a three-game drought on the road and puts them at 4-6.
Everything went Evansville Central's way against Princeton in their previous matchup back in September of 2023 as Evansville Central made off with a 3-0 win. Will Evansville Central repeat their success, or does Princeton have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
